Fix bug in PEI's virtual-register scavenging This change fixes a bug that I introduced in r178058. After a register is scavenged using one of the available spills slots the instruction defining the virtual register needs to be moved to after the spill code. The scavenger has already processed the defining instruction so that registers killed by that instruction are available for definition in that same instruction. Unfortunately, after this, the scavenger needs to iterate through the spill code and then visit, again, the instruction that defines the now-scavenged register. In order to avoid confusion, the register scavenger needs the ability to 'back up' through the spill code so that it can again process the instructions in the appropriate order. Prior to this fix, once the scavenger reached the just-moved instruction, it would assert if it killed any registers because, having already processed the instruction, it believed they were undefined. Unfortunately, I don't yet have a small test case. Update PEI's virtual-register-based scavenging to support multiple simultaneous mappings The previous algorithm could not deal properly with scavenging multiple virtual registers because it kept only one live virtual -> physical mapping (and iterated through operands in order). Now we don't maintain a current mapping, but rather use replaceRegWith to completely remove the virtual register as soon as the mapping is established. In order to allow the register scavenger to return a physical register killed by an instruction for definition by that same instruction, we now call RS->forward(I) prior to eliminating virtual registers defined in I. This requires a minor update to forward to ignore virtual registers. Allow the register scavenger to spill multiple registers This patch lets the register scavenger make use of multiple spill slots in order to guarantee that it will be able to provide multiple registers simultaneously. To support this, the RS's API has changed slightly: setScavengingFrameIndex / getScavengingFrameIndex have been replaced by addScavengingFrameIndex / isScavengingFrameIndex / getScavengingFrameIndices. In forthcoming commits, the PowerPC backend will use this capability in order to implement the spilling of condition registers, and some special-purpose registers, without relying on r0 being reserved. In some cases, spilling these registers requires two GPRs: one for addressing and one to hold the value being transferred. git-svn-id: https://llvm.org/svn/llvm-project/llvm/trunk@177774 91177308-0d34-0410-b5e6-96231b3b80d8

[reg scavenger] Fix the isUsed/isAliasUsed functions so as to not report a false positive. In this particular case, R6 was being spilled by the register scavenger when it was in fact dead. The isUsed function reported R6 as used because the R6_R7 alias was reserved (due to the fact that we've reserved R7 as the FP). The solution is to only check if the original register (i.e., R6) isReserved and not the aliases. The aliases are only checked to make sure they're available. Add register-reuse to frame-index register scavenging. When a target uses a virtual register to eliminate a frame index, it can return that register and the constant stored there to PEI to track. When scavenging to allocate for those registers, PEI then tracks the last-used register and value, and if it is still available and matches the value for the next index, reuses the existing value rather and removes the re-materialization instructions. Fancier tracking and adjustment of scavenger allocations to keep more values live for longer is possible, but not yet implemented and would likely be better done via a different, less special-purpose, approach to the problem. eliminateFrameIndex() is modified so the target implementations can return the registers they wish to be tracked for reuse. ARM Thumb1 implements and utilizes the new mechanism. All other targets are simply modified to adjust for the changed eliminateFrameIndex() prototype. git-svn-id: https://llvm.org/svn/llvm-project/llvm/trunk@83467 91177308-0d34-0410-b5e6-96231b3b80d8

Rebuild RegScavenger::DistanceMap each time it is needed. The register scavenger maintains a DistanceMap that maps MI pointers to their distance from the top of the current MBB. The DistanceMap is built incrementally in forward() and in bulk in findFirstUse(). It is used by scavengeRegister() to determine which candidate register has the longest unused interval. Unfortunately the DistanceMap contents can become outdated. The first time scavengeRegister() is called, the DistanceMap is filled to cover the MBB. If then instructions are inserted in the MBB (as they always are following scavengeRegister()), the recorded distances are too short. This causes bad behaviour in the included test case where a register use /after/ the current position is ignored because findFirstUse() thinks is is /before/ the current position. A "using an undefined register" assertion follows promptly. The fix is to build a fresh DistanceMap at the top of scavengeRegister(), and discard it after use. This means that DistanceMap is no longer needed as a RegScavenger member variable, and forward() doesn't need to update it. The fix then discloses issue number two in the same test case: The candidate search in scavengeRegister() finds a CSR that has been saved in the prologue, but is currently unused. It would be both inefficient and wrong to spill such a register in the emergency spill slot. In the present case, the emergency slot restore is placed immediately before the normal epilogue restore, leading to a "Redefining a live register" assertion. Fix number two: When scavengerRegister() stumbles upon an unused register that is overwritten later in the MBB, return that register early. It is important to verify that the register is defined later in the MBB, otherwise it might be an unspilled CSR. git-svn-id: https://llvm.org/svn/llvm-project/llvm/trunk@78650 91177308-0d34-0410-b5e6-96231b3b80d8

Add a bit IsUndef to MachineOperand. This indicates the def / use register operand is defined by an implicit_def. That means it can def / use any register and passes (e.g. register scavenger) can feel free to ignore them. The register allocator, when it allocates a register to a virtual register defined by an implicit_def, can allocate any physical register without worrying about overlapping live ranges. It should mark all of operands of the said virtual register so later passes will do the right thing. This is not the best solution. But it should be a lot less fragile to having the scavenger try to track what is defined by implicit_def. git-svn-id: https://llvm.org/svn/llvm-project/llvm/trunk@74518 91177308-0d34-0410-b5e6-96231b3b80d8
